Explore the Majestic Mala Papalićeva Palača

Mala Papalićeva palača, or the Little Papalić Palace, stands as a magnificent testament to the rich history and architectural elegance of Split, Croatia. This historical landmark is a striking example of Renaissance architecture, showcasing intricate details and a majestic facade that attracts visitors from around the world. As you approach the palace, you are greeted by its grand entrance and ornate decorations that reflect the artistry of the time. The building is not only an architectural marvel but also a significant part of the cultural heritage of the city, offering insights into the lives of its former inhabitants. Inside, the palace features beautifully preserved rooms that transport you back to a bygone era. Each chamber is adorned with artworks and artifacts that tell the story of the region’s history, making it an enlightening experience for history buffs and casual visitors alike. The atmosphere within the palace is serene, allowing guests to wander through its halls and appreciate the artistry that has stood the test of time.
